How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hy View?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hy View Studio Apartments | $1,329 | $825 | $2,185 |
| Hy View 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,553 | $850 | $8,329 |
| Hy View 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,951 | $1,150 | $4,995 |
| Hy View 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,930 | $1,630 | $8,765 |
| Hy View 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,373 | $2,549 | $6,780 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Hy View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Hy View?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Hy View is at Viviendas Scottsdale listed at $820.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Hy View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Hy View is $2,029.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Hy View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Hy View is a 1,677 square feet unit starting from $1,869 at The Griffin.
What is the average size for Hy View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Hy View is currently at 624 sq ft.
